Mastering Coriolis Master Meter Performance

How can you make your master meters measure smarter, more reliably, and achieve better measurement uncertainty? In this webinar, VSL shows how you can improve your performance — based on our own experience.

During this session, Erik Smits, Chief Metrologist Flow at VSL, will guide you through the unique reference flow meter architecture of our European Center for Flow Measurement (ECFM). Discover how one of our Water Flow Facilities uses four parallel master meters that can also be partially switched in series, enabling calibration strategies far beyond what most laboratories can achieve.

If you are familiar with the traditional Z configuration, you will want to explore the innovative X configuration of the VSL Water Flow 2500.

What you will learn

  • Why and how master meters can be calibrated using other master meters
  • The impact on repeatability when operating 1, 2, 3, or all 4 reference meters
  • How gravimetric traceability anchors every measurement result
  • The differences between the gravimetric method and the master meter method
  • How international consistency is ensured (EURAMET project 1616)
  • How VSL can support calibration up to 2500 t/h (m³/h), including uncertainty performance
